Conservation volunteers

What You'll Do: 

Sutton House are looking to expand the volunteer team that help us to share and care for the oldest house in Hackney.

 

Conservation Volunteers: 

Help to look after our wonderful objects and interiors, so people can enjoy them today and for generations to come. Join the team, assisting with housekeeping and collections care on a weekly basis. 

 

When?

Tuesdays and/or Thursdays (weekly or fortnightly commitment)
